APPROVAL OF WORK ORDER NO. 4 -RR FOR THE ROCKRIDGE <br />SUBDIVISION SURGE PROTECTION PROJECT <br />(Clerk's Note: This item was heard after Item 11..14. and is placed here for <br />continuity). <br />Public Works Director Jim Davis presented this item by recapping his September <br />10, 2007 memorandum. The Work Order would authorize the consultants, Malcolm <br />Pirnie, Inc., to redesign the pump station and complete the final engineering drawings, <br />which must be done if the project will be constructed in the future. Director Davis <br />divulged that the cost for the Work Order is $98,652.80, and the cost for the Rockridge <br />Surge Protection Project is ±$5,000,000.00. Even with the possibility of securing the $1.2 <br />million FEMA grant, funding would still have to be solidified for the remaining $3.8 <br />million. <br />September 18, 2007 39 <br />
